Intertextile Shanghai Apparel Fabrics to use digital solutions to reconnect suppliers and buyers

  

The organizers of Intertextile Shanghai Apparel Fabrics will be using digital solutions to support for exhibitors and visitors who originally intended to participate in the Spring edition of Intertextile in Shanghai this March, as well as those unable to join the upcoming Autumn Edition from September 23-25. This month’s show expects about 3400 exhibitors from over 20 countries and regions.

Organizers have launched Intertextile mobile app, an online business matching platform that continues to utilize its diverse network in the textiles industry to help address sourcing needs and generate new business opportunities. They have been closely in touch with overseas exhibitors and visitors to prepare for the Autumn Edition of Intertextile.

The digitized solutions will cater for all scenarios – domestic and overseas suppliers and buyers -- who have been eager to connect with each other fter missing out the Spring Edition of Intertextile, while serving as pre-event promotion, business and networking opportunities for the Autumn edition. This will facilitate a seamless exchange of information for doing international business online and offline before, during and after the fair to truly support the industry’s recovery

Intertextile’s digitized solutions will allow exhibitors to gain access to its valuable database of over 100,000 buyers from over 100 countries and regions. Exhibitors will also have access to buyers’ contacts so that they can schedule online or onsite meetings in advance via the app’s built-in messenger function. Intertextile is also extending its offer for exhibitors and visitors to access its online business matching platform, Connect PLUS which allows exhibitors to check out overseas buyer profiles from Intertextile’s valuable database and proactively send out requests to connect.
